About Kylier
Kylier is a modern name with American origins. It's a variation of Kylie, giving a fresh, unique feel to a well-known name. The name evokes a sense of charm, grace, and adventure. However, Kylier's roots might also extend further. Some believe it connects to Kylie, a name possibly derived from an Australian Aboriginal word meaning "boomerang" or "boomerang-like."
